Once On This Island

Immerse yourself in a Tony-award winning masterpiece Once On This Island, a captivating saga of gods, lovers, and societal clash. Presented by the Monday Show Entertainment team, this locally reimagined musical will showcase over 50 homegrown talents and promises an unforgettable musical experience that explores themes of love, class, and the power of storytelling. We find out more from the production’s director, Dominic Lucien Luk, and cast member Bihzhu.
